什么是imToken? imToken是一款数字资产管理工具,可以用于管理多种加密货币和代币。它提供了一个安全的数字钱包,...
随着区块链技术的不断发展,越来越多的企业和开发者开始致力于开发基于区块链的应用程序(DApp)。其中,Tokenimapp作为一种集成加密货币的移动应用程序,越来越受到用户的关注。本文将详细探讨如何开发Tokenimapp,从概念形成到实际上线的全流程。此外,还将深入分析用户在开发过程中可能遇到的多种相关问题,以便为开发者提供更全面的参考。
Tokenimapp是一种专注于加密货币及其生态的移动应用程序。该应用旨在为用户提供方便的加密货币管理、交易、存储及获取实时市场数据等服务。通过Tokenimapp,用户可以轻松地管理他们的数字资产,并与其它用户进行交易,提供了一个安全、高效的加密货币交易及管理平台。
开发Tokenimapp之前,开发者需要掌握以下关键知识:
开发Tokenimapp可以分为几个主要阶段:
在开始开发之前,首先需要确定应用的目标用户群体和所需功能。可以进行市场调研,了解用户需求,制定应用功能列表和用户故事。
基于需求选择一个合适的区块链平台,如以太坊、波场或Binance Smart Chain,这些平台都有着不同的特性和优势,开发者需要根据自己的需求选择。
一旦选定平台,开发者可以使用Solidity等编程语言来编写智能合约。智能合约是Tokenimapp的“心脏”,包含所有的交易逻辑,如资产转移、用户验证等。
接下来,需要设计并开发移动应用的用户界面和后端服务,确保用户可以方便地与智能合约进行交互。选择合适的框架,如React Native或Flutter,可用于跨平台开发。
开发完成后,进行全面的测试,包括功能测试、安全测试和用户体验测试,确保应用在各类环境下的表现都能满足标准。
测试无误后,应用可以上线至Google Play和App Store,并进行有效的市场推广,包括社交媒体宣传、广告投放等,吸引用户下载与使用。
以下是用户在Tokenimapp开发过程中可能遇到的6个相关问题,以及每个问题的详细解析:
在开发Tokenimapp之前,识别并定义核心功能至关重要。这些功能应当涵盖用户在日常使用中最需要的服务。
核心功能可能包括:
在定义核心功能时,还应考虑用户体验,确保界面友好,操作流畅,以提升用户满意度。
安全性是任何基于区块链的应用程序至关重要的部分,尤其涉及用户资金和敏感信息时。确保应用的安全需要多方面的措施:
第一步是采用强密码政策,要求用户设置复杂密码并定期更换。第二,启用两步验证,以增强账户安全。第三,应用高标准的加密技术,确保用户信息在传输和存储过程中不会被泄露。此外,针对智能合约的安全审计至关重要,定期检测代码漏洞,确保应用程序在各类攻击下的稳定性,避免风险。
最后,准备应急响应计划,如果发生安全事件,能够迅速采取措施,减少损失。
Tokenimapp的开发时间因项目规模和复杂性而异。一般来说,从概念到上线的完整流程可能需要数月时间。
具体来说,以下因素会影响开发时间:
因此,合理估计开发时间时,应考虑各个阶段的时间安排,并预留足够的时间用于修复bug和用户反馈的响应。
为了支持多种加密货币,Tokenimapp需要处理不同类型的区块链网络和令牌标准(如ERC-20)。在开发过程中,可以采取以下措施:
首先,在智能合约层面,可以创建一个通用接口,通过该接口处理各种资产的转账和兑换。此外,可以使用第三方API接口,获取不同币种的实时价格,确保用户可以实时查看资产价值。
其次,在应用层面,设计一个灵活的用户界面,允许用户轻松切换和管理他们的不同币种。为每种支持的币种提供详细的使用指南,包括如何购买、出售和交易。
最后,确保应用在每种货币的区块链上进行充分的测试,以改进功能和用户体验,保障多币种的高效管理和安全性。
市场营销是Tokenimapp成功的关键之一。以下是一些有效的市场推广策略:
首先,建立一个专业的网站,展示Tokenimapp的独特功能和优势。网站应包含用户评价、教程和常见问题区域,以帮助用户理解和使用应用。此外,搜索引擎()可以帮助提高可见性,吸引更多用户。
其次,利用社交媒体平台(如Twitter、Telegram、Reddit等)与潜在用户互动。分享最新动态、功能更新和市场信息可以增强用户参与度并建立社区。
最后,可以考虑与行业内的影响者或其他项目合作,进行交叉推广,提高应用的知名度和用户基础。通过参加行业会议和活动,与潜在用户直接面对面沟通也是一个有效的推广策略。
Tokenimapp上线后,维护和更新是确保应用持续运作的必要步骤。后期维护应考虑以下几个方面:
首先,定期进行应用性能监控,确保服务器在高负载时能够稳定运行。还应关注用户反馈,及时修复bug和漏洞,提供及时的技术支持。
其次,关注市场动态和用户需求变化,定期推出版本更新,增加新功能,用户体验。此外,确保在应用更新时不会影响现有用户数据的安全和完整性。
最后,定期进行安全审计,确保智能合约和应用代码的安全性,以防止黑客攻击和资产被盗事件的发生。
总结来说,Tokenimapp的开发是一个复杂而系统的过程,需要涉及多个环节的紧密配合。通过科学的规划和严谨的实施,可以构建一个安全、高效且用户友好的加密货币管理应用。